dc.description.abstract© 2021 IEEE.The genetic algorithms are a well-known family of high-performance probabilistic algorithms. In this paper, we explore the possibility of using the genetic algorithm for the Knapsack problem to compromise the security of a Knapsack cipher. Despite being much faster than the exact algorithms, the genetic algorithm for the Knapsack problem may fail to find a solution. We explore the connection between the success rate of the genetic algorithm and the Knapsack problem parameters: the Knapsack Density, the items count in the solution and whether the Knapsack is modular or multiplicative. As a result, we determine whether the genetic algorithm is viable as an analysis tool for the Knapsack ciphers with specific parameters.
